有没有人知道如何将exif数据和注释字段添加到fancybox弹出窗口
添加 jQuery.exif 很简单..但是如何在弹出窗口中显示它是问题?
$("a.your_image_class").fancybox({
'title':|'Taken with a ' + $(this).exif("Make") + ' '
+ $(this).exif("Model") + ' on ' + $
(this).exif("DateTimeOriginal"|)
comma if last attribute
}); | alert( + ));
有人可以提供帮助吗? 谢谢 梅拉妮
答案 0 :(得分:0)
如果您使用的是fancybox v2.x,则可以使用beforeShow
回调设置title
BUT定位.fancybox-image
选择器(实际图片fancybox)喜欢:
$(".fancybox").fancybox({
beforeShow : function () {
this.title = 'Taken with a ' + $(".fancybox-image").exif("Make") +
' ' + $(".fancybox-image").exif("Model") +
' on ' + $(".fancybox-image").exif("DateTimeOriginal");
}
});
注意:未经过测试,但如果您说已经使 jQuery.exif 插件工作,那么您应该没有任何问题。